About Large Red
Original seed from the USDA. Prior to the Civil War, Large Red was one of the most favored tomato varieties in the U.S. It was listed in the 1843 Shaker seed catalog and Fearing Burr stated in his 1865 book, “From the time of the introduction of the tomato to its general use in this country, the ‘Large Red’ was almost the only kind cultivated, or even commonly known.” Indeterminate, regular-leaf tomato plants that yield in generous amounts 1-2 pound, 4-inch, heavily ribbed, flattened, beautiful, red, beefsteak tomatoes that shout out terrific, complex, well-balanced, sweet flavors with that old-fashioned acidic ‘tang’ that makes it a winner. A perfect tomato for slicing fresh into sandwiches or salads.
